Hello Richard Williams,
To change the account email, Sign in to the AxCrypt account site https://account.axcrypt.net/en/Home/Login with the email address and then go to Security | Email to set the new email.
When doing the email changes, we have to be careful with the email addresses and its accounts. There must not already be such an account. If there is, please delete it first. – Means we can change the AxCrypt account email address to new email address which is not associated with any other AxCrypt accounts.

Hello Chris,
This might be because of problem with a dot net framework or some other third party applications are not allowing the AxCrypt app to run. Please check your operating system has any pending updates. If any, please update.
Please check whether your operating system has dot net framework 4.5 or above? If not please install the same. You can download the dot net framework here, https://www.microsoft.com/en-us/download/details.aspx?id=30653 .
Also Please try to check any firewall or antivirus software’s are blocking the AxCrypt app or not? If blocked, please add the AxCrypt app in the app’s whitelist. Then restart your system and install the AxCrypt app.
Please delete the folder %LocalAppData%\AxCrypt(C:\Users\’User Name’\AppData\Local\AxCrypt) to clear the local cache and starts the AxCrypt app like a new.
Then uninstall the AxCrypt app and restart the system then install the latest version of the AxCrypt app You can download the same from our official website: https://www.axcrypt.net/download/ . (if already download, please ignore it).
Now install the AxCrypt app and try to start AxCrypting……
